Geoff Dembicki
19 November 2022
What if oil executives had actually taken seriously the climate warnings given by their own scientists?

In an extract from his new book, Geoff Dembicki asks how the world would be now if the oil sands industry had not been so successful in blocking action to stop the climate emergency
Read the full article